Wynn has won five awards in the 4th National Human Resources Innovation Competition, achieving its best performance to date. The awards recognize the company’s contributions to corporate culture, talent development, youth employment, SME empowerment, and diversity and inclusion.

The competition, which began in August 2024, attracted more than 500 entries, with 104 companies receiving awards.

Wynn received the “Outstanding Brand in Corporate Culture Development” and “Outstanding Brand in Talent Development and Organizational Strategy” awards. The company said these reflect its commitment to fostering a diverse corporate culture, implementing employee training programs and enhancing workplace well-being. Wynn also continues to invest in talent development through initiatives such as the Wynn Management Skills Programme and Certificate in Integrated Resort Management, aimed at cultivating professionals with global perspectives.

Wynn won three more awards, namely “2024 Outstanding Brand in Supporting Youth  Employment and Development”, “2024 Outstanding Brand in Supporting and Strengthening Competitiveness of SMEs” and “2024 Outstanding Brand in Developing Culture of Diversity and  Inclusion”.

The company said these awards recognize its efforts in youth employment training, SME support and community integration. Its initiatives include the U18 Youth Career and Leadership Development Programme, a hospitality management certification program in partnership with EHL Hospitality Business School in Switzerland. The company also supports local SMEs in many ways from equipment improvement schemes to digital transformation and has implemented many community inclusion initiatives, such as the Rua da Felicidade Pedestrian Zone project and the Wynn Employee Volunteer Team.

The National Human Resources Innovation Competition is organized by the CCOIC Human Resource Management Commission and HRLead, and is co-hosted by business associations in Guangdong, Hong Kong and Macau. It is considered one of the most prominent events in the human resources sector.
